The Rule of Three

The rule of three is simple but very powerful: Whatever you do comes back to you threefold.

This is not only in magick, but in every aspect of life. Witches are warned in the Wiccan Rede to "ever mind the rule of three." So remember to think before you act, or you could suffer serious consequences.

Ask anyone who did a less than nice spell on someone what repercussions they had. They are never pretty.

Most Wiccans also believe in Karma, a phenomenon that guides the soul toward evolving acts. While it isn't quite a cosmic system of checks and balances, good brings good and bad propagates bad.

Wiccans don't believe in predestination. We make the choices that pattern our lives. We are responsible for our own actions -- we have no one to blame for them except ourselves.

In some religions, there is a belief that you will get your rewards and punishments after you die, in the afterlife. Because of this, many people think they can get away with things, not having to face up to their responsibilities until after death. Not so in Witchcraft. We believe that we are responsible for our actions right here and now. (Raymond Buckland).



Below are some commonly used seals for spells that are evermindful of the rule of three:

By the power of three times three, this spell is bound so mote it be.

****

By the karmic power of the number three
This spell tied or knotted be
So that its contents stay together
And can't harm human, beast or weather
(Dorothy Morrison)
